ceebmoj said: So only about 1M of buying a T44 is it any good? my favourite tank- more so than the T54 which comes after it. You can dmage just about anything in it (although you need to be careful with a Maus and E-100), the gun is accurate and powerful, its fast, and with a bit of angling it will bounce a surprising number of shots. usually vastly under-rated by opposition heaveis. oh and with a well trained crew you can disappear into the smallest folds of the ground and tehn re-appear somewhere else- very deadly for the opposition. Play this as much as my E-50! (and i only play mediums...)

McSam said: I knew this, but had no idea how much - half a f  king million, that's incredible! Can any of you guys give a ballpark on how clan wars pay? Struggling to find info on it. I have a clan lined up, I need tier 8 tank to get in and my first will be Pershing, though I doubt that'll get me involved in live battles! Clans obtain gold by fighting over territory, and retaining it once won. Different territories pay differing amounts of gold, which is accumulatged on a daily basis all the time the clan retains the territory. The gold acquired by the clan can then be distributed amongst it's members, to ensure that they have got all the required upgrades on their tanks to defend the territory from attackers. Some clans own several territories and will be earning several thousand gold on a daily basis. It's a bit catch 22. You need territories to earn lots of gold, but as a small clan with no gold, it's difficult for your clan members to equip their tanks to their utmost best to give you a chance of acquiring and holding on to territories.
